When it comes to fire safety, understanding the terminology around materials is essential. One term that often comes up is "noncombustible." But what does it mean? You know what? If a material does not burn, it is considered noncombustible. This means that when exposed to fire, it won't ignite or sustain combustion. Makes sense, right?

Now, let’s unpack that a bit. You wouldn’t want materials in your home or workplace that could easily catch fire. So, noncombustible materials serve as a safer option in construction and furnishings. Imagine living in a fire-prone area; wouldn’t you feel more secure knowing the building materials won’t turn your home into an inferno?

Let’s clarify some terms here. When something is labeled as combustible, that means it has the potential to catch fire. Highly flammable? Well, that’s even riskier—it’s like waving a red flag in front of a bull. These materials can ignite quickly and burn fiercely. On the flip side, smoke resistant materials are designed to minimize the spread of smoke, which can be just as dangerous during a fire as the flames themselves.
